FILE: build-aux/osx/BuildUniversal.sh
================================================
# First build ARM64 version...
echo "Building arm64 binary..."
dub build --build=release --config=osx-full --arch=arm64-apple-macos
mv "out/Inochi Session.app/Contents/MacOS/inochi-session" "out/Inochi Session.app/Contents/MacOS/inochi-session-arm64"
# Then the X86_64 version...
echo "Building x86_64 binary..."
dub build --build=release --config=osx-full --arch=x86_64-apple-macos
mv "out/Inochi Session.app/Contents/MacOS/inochi-session" "out/Inochi Session.app/Contents/MacOS/inochi-session-x86_64"
# Glue them together with lipo
echo "Gluing them together..."
lipo "out/Inochi Session.app/Contents/MacOS/inochi-session-x86_64" "out/Inochi Session.app/Contents/MacOS/inochi-session-arm64" -output "out/Inochi Session.app/Contents/MacOS/inochi-session" -create
# Print some nice info
echo "Done!"
lipo -info "out/Inochi Session.app/Contents/MacOS/inochi-session"
# Cleanup and bundle
echo "Cleaning up..."
rm "out/Inochi Session.app/Contents/MacOS/inochi-session-x86_64" "out/Inochi Session.app/Contents/MacOS/inochi-session-arm64"
./osxbundle.sh

FILE: source/inochi2d/nio/puppet.d
================================================
module inochi2d.nio.puppet;
import inochi2d;
import niobium;
import numem;
import nulib.collections;
import nulib.math : min, max;
/**
A niobium renderered puppet.
*/
class NioPuppet : NuRefCounted {
private:
@nogc:
// Puppet info
Puppet puppet_;
// Render handles
NioDevice device_;
NioBuffer vtx_;
NioBuffer idx_;
NioTexture[] tex_;
// Creates the puppet and its associated buffers.
void createPuppet(string file) {
this.puppet_ = assumeNoThrowNoGC(&ins_puppet_load_pinned, file);
this.tex_ = nu_malloca!NioTexture(puppet_.textureCache.cache.length);
foreach(i, ref Texture texture; puppet_.textureCache.cache) {
tex_[i] = device_.createTexture(NioTextureDescriptor(
type: NioTextureType.type2D,
format: NioPixelFormat.rgba8UnormSRGB,
storage: NioStorageMode.privateStorage,
usage: NioTextureUsage.transfer | NioTextureUsage.sampled,
width: texture.width,
height: texture.height,
)).upload(NioRegion3D(0, 0, 0, texture.width, texture.height, 1), 0, 0, texture.pixels, 0);
}
// NOTE: We create the initial buffers here,
// the buffer sizes are not known until an update
// has occured, so we do a 0 ms update.
assumeNoThrowNoGC(&ins_puppet_update_pinned, puppet_, 0);
size_t vtxSize = puppet.drawList.vertices.length * VtxData.sizeof;
size_t idxSize = puppet.drawList.indices.length * uint.sizeof;
vtx_ = device_.createBuffer(NioBufferDescriptor(
storage: NioStorageMode.privateStorage,
usage: NioBufferUsage.transfer | NioBufferUsage.vertexBuffer,
size: cast(uint)vtxSize
));
idx_ = device_.createBuffer(NioBufferDescriptor(
storage: NioStorageMode.privateStorage,
usage: NioBufferUsage.transfer | NioBufferUsage.indexBuffer,
size: cast(uint)idxSize
));
}
// Resizes the vertex and index buffers.
void resizeBuffers() {
size_t vtxSize = puppet.drawList.vertices.length * VtxData.sizeof;
size_t idxSize = puppet.drawList.indices.length * uint.sizeof;
if (vtxSize > vtx_.size) {
vtx_.release();
vtx_ = device_.createBuffer(NioBufferDescriptor(
storage: NioStorageMode.privateStorage,
usage: NioBufferUsage.transfer | NioBufferUsage.vertexBuffer,
size: cast(uint)vtxSize
));
}
if (idxSize > idx_.size) {
idx_.release();
idx_ = device_.createBuffer(NioBufferDescriptor(
storage: NioStorageMode.privateStorage,
usage: NioBufferUsage.transfer | NioBufferUsage.indexBuffer,
size: cast(uint)idxSize
));
}
}
public:
/**
The underlying Inochi2D Puppet
*/
@property Puppet puppet() => puppet_;
/**
The loaded textures of the puppet.
*/
@property NioTexture[] textures() => tex_;
/**
Vertex data of the puppet.
*/
@property VtxData[] vertices() => puppet.drawList.vertices;
/**
The puppet's vertex buffer.
*/
@property NioBuffer vertexBuffer() => vtx_;
/**
Index data of the puppet.
*/
@property uint[] indices() => puppet.drawList.indices;
/**
The puppet's index buffer.
*/
@property NioBuffer indexBuffer() => idx_;
/**
Draw commands of the puppet.
*/
@property DrawCmd[] commands() => puppet.drawList.commands;
/**
Total size of the puppet's buffers.
*/
@property size_t totalBufferSize() => vtx_.size + idx_.size;
// Destructor
~this() {
assumeNoThrowNoGC(&ins_puppet_unload_pinned, puppet);
if (vtx_) vtx_.release();
if (idx_) idx_.release();
foreach(ref NioTexture texture; tex_)
texture.release();
nu_freea(tex_);
}
/**
Loads a puppet.
*/
this(NioDevice device, string file) {
this.device_ = device;
this.createPuppet(file);
}
/**
Updates the puppet and resizes vertex and index buffers if needed.
Params:
delta = Time since last frame.
*/
void update(float delta) {
assumeNoThrowNoGC(&ins_puppet_update_pinned, puppet_, delta);
this.resizeBuffers();
}
}
private:
extern(C) void ins_puppet_update_pinned(Puppet puppet, float delta) {
puppet.update(delta);
puppet.draw(delta);
}
extern(C) Puppet ins_puppet_load_pinned(string file) {
import core.memory : GC;
auto puppet_ = inLoadPuppet(file);
GC.addRoot(cast(void*)puppet_);
return puppet_;
}
extern(C) void ins_puppet_unload_pinned(Puppet puppet) {
import core.memory : GC;
GC.removeRoot(cast(void*)puppet);
}

FILE: source/inochi2d/nio/staging.d
================================================
module inochi2d.nio.staging;
import nulib.collections;
import niobium;
import numem;
/**
A managed staging buffer.
*/
class NioStagingBuffer : NuRefCounted {
private:
@nogc:
NioDevice device_;
NioBuffer buffer_;
size_t alignment_;
/// Creates initial 32 mb buffer.
void createBuffer() {
buffer_ = device_.createBuffer(NioBufferDescriptor(
storage: NioStorageMode.sharedStorage,
usage: NioBufferUsage.transfer,
size: 33_554_432
));
}
public:
/**
The underlying staging buffer.
*/
@property NioBuffer buffer() => buffer_;
/**
Alignment of allocations in the buffer.
*/
@property size_t alignment() => alignment_;
/**
Size of the buffer.
*/
@property size_t size() => buffer_.size();
// Destructor
~this() {
buffer_.release();
}
/**
Creates a new managed staging buffer.
Params:
device = The device that owns the staging buffer.
alignment = The increments that the staging buffer will grow.
*/
this(NioDevice device, size_t alignment = 33_554_432) {
this.device_ = device;
this.alignment_ = alignment;
this.createBuffer();
}
/**
Resizes the buffer.
Params:
newSize = The new size to request from the memory pool.
Notes:
The size will be aligned to $(D alignment).
*/
void resize(size_t newSize) {
if (newSize > buffer_.size) {
buffer_ = device_.createBuffer(NioBufferDescriptor(
storage: NioStorageMode.sharedStorage,
usage: NioBufferUsage.transfer,
size: cast(uint)nu_alignup(newSize, alignment_)
));
}
}
/**
Uploads data to the buffer at the given offset.
Params:
offset = Offset into the staging buffer to upload to.
data = The data to upload.
Returns:
The ending offset of the upload.
*/
ptrdiff_t upload(size_t offset, void[] data) {
if (offset+data.length > this.size)
return -1;
if (auto mapped = buffer_.map()) {
mapped[offset..offset+data.length] = data[0..$];
buffer_.unmap();
}
return offset+data.length;
}
}
